Advice on Finance

Raising finance for a new music business is not easy. If you expect a third party to finance you then you will need to produce a business plan. Personal Investment

  • Your own money – this is your business and if you are not prepared to back it why should anybody else?

  • Private Investment – will friends and family back your idea?

Public Sector Funding

Have a look at these websites for guidance and advice. Business Link advisors will be able to guide you about new funding streams that are being offered and Generator can also help with more specific music business enquiries.

You need to be aware that these organisations do have very different aims and objectives (outputs) so try and find out what they are. Business Link may have very different criteria to the Arts Council or Princes Trust.

Equity Investments – Business Angels

Business Angels are usually wealthy individuals who invest in new and growing businesses in return for a share of the equity. Contact: National Business Angels Network 020 7329 2929

Fan Finance and Digital Finance

Marillion were one of the first bands to ask fans to ‘invest’ in their releases.  Since then, more and more established bands have been using other 'online' digital financing solutions through sites such as BandStocks, Slice the Pie and SellaBand
